When do children with Aspergers Syndrome go undiagnosed?

When do children with Aspergers Syndrome go undiagnosed?

A child who shows passion in academics or a great talent in arts is often praised and rewarded instead of taken for an evaluation. When the behaviors are disruptive to the life of the child, family, or classroom it could be a sign that the child needs to be assessed.

Is the term Asperger’s still used in the UK?

‘Asperger’s disorder’, or ‘Asperger’s syndrome’, is actually no longer an official diagnosis in the UK (or the USA, for that matter). Since 2013 this was dropped in favour of ‘autism spectrum disorder’ (ASD). But those who had a diagnosis before the change still use the term ‘Asperger’s’, ‘Aspie’ for short,…

What kind of Doctor to see for adult Aspergers?

If you decide to pursue a professional diagnosis, it’s important to find a psychologist, psychiatrist or neuropsychologist experienced in diagnosing adults with ASD. If your child has received a diagnosis, his or her clinician may be able to refer you to someone who does adult assessments.

Why do so many children with Asperger syndrome go undiagnosed?

Many children with Asperger’s Syndrome go undiagnosed mainly because the symptoms are dismissed as a behavioral problem that can be outgrown. In fact, recent research suggests that as many as 50% of the children with this disorder go undiagnosed.
